SP urges Brahmans to uproot BSP from UP

Mainpuri, Oct 11 (UNI) Calling upon the Brahaman samaj to extend their support to his party, Samajwadi Party supremo Mulayam Singh Yadav said the Mayawati-led BSP government could be uprooted from the state if Brahmans join hand with the party.

While addressing a public meeting at National Degree College here today, the SP supremo said BSP government was resting on the strong base created by the Brahmans, however, they are being mistreated and mislead by the same government.

Had the upper caste supported the SP in the last assembly election, BSP would not have won and the picture of the state would have been totally different, he stressed.

Mr Yadav urged the Brahmans to support the party, saying SP is so powerful that if the strength of upper class join it, BSP governemnt would stand no where in the state.
